AS 37.23.050. Investment Management.

The public entities participating in an investment pool under this chapter shall provide for management of investments in the pool by contracting for investment management and related services with

(1) a securities broker-dealer registered under AS 45.55.030 and under 15 U.S.C. 78o (Securities Exchange Act of 1934);

(2) a state investment adviser registered under AS 45.55.030 or a federal covered adviser that has made a notice filing under AS 45.55.040(h);

(3) the Department of Revenue; or

(4) a financial institution that is a state or federally chartered commercial or mutual bank, savings and loan association, or credit union if the institution's accounts are insured through the appropriate federal insuring agency of the United States and if the institution has trust powers under state or federal law.
